About Lake Erie Men's Lacrosse
Lake Erie men's lacrosse competes in NCAA Division II as a member of the Great Midwest Athletic Conference (G-MAC). The Storm represent Lake Erie College in Painesville, Ohio, and play conference opponents including Tiffin, Walsh, Malone, Davenport, and Northwood. The program is housed within a small private liberal arts college on Lake Erie's southern shore.

Lake Erie College is a private liberal arts college in Painesville, Ohio, founded in 1856 as a female seminary and converted to coeducation in 1985. The college enrolls about 678 students, with a 64.1% acceptance rate and an average SAT around 1,114.
Lake Erie men's lacrosse closed the 2026 regular season at 4-10 overall in G-MAC play. The Storm won three of their final four games, including a 13-12 road win over Point Park on April 21 and a 13-6 senior day win over Tiffin on April 18. Two Storm players earned All-G-MAC Second Team honors on April 29, 2026.
